GStreamer-CRITICAL

Use this category to discuss anything related to the development of Guayadeque.
Locked
mr_hangman
Posts: 70
Joined: Tue Sep 28, 2010 12:22 am

GStreamer-CRITICAL

Post by mr_hangman »

I'm not sure what happened. The music stopped and I saw this message.
I just updated to 1415 by the way.

[New Thread 0xa3dfbb70 (LWP 26547)]
[Thread 0xa25f8b70 (LWP 26545) exited]
[New Thread 0x9d5eeb70 (LWP 26548)]
06:07:14 PM: OnMediaBitrate... (1294078030) 192000
06:07:14 PM: guMediaCtrl::DoCleanUp
06:07:14 PM: guFaderPlayBin::~guFaderPlayBin (1294078024)

(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element playbin2inputselector8,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.

[Thread 0xa82b4b70 (LWP 13775) exited]

(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element abin, but it is in PLAYING inst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element audiotee,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element playsink1, but it is in PLAYING inst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element play, but it is in PLAYING inst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.

06:07:14 PM: Finished destroying the playbin 1294078024

(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element volume,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element aresample,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element aconv,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


(guayadeque:12808): GStreamer-CRITICAL **:
Trying to dispose element aqueue, but it is in PAUSED instead of the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.
This problem may also be caused by a refcounting bug in the
application or some element.


GThread-ERROR **: file gthread-posix.c: line 171 (g_mutex_free_posix_impl): error 'Device or resource busy' during 'pthread_mutex_destroy ((pthread_mutex_t *) mutex)'
aborting...

Program received signal SIGABRT, Aborted.
0xb7fe1424 in __kernel_vsyscall ()
(gdb) bt
#0 0xb7fe1424 in __kernel_vsyscall ()
#1 0xb71d3c91 in raise () from /lib/libc.so.6
#2 0xb71d551e in abort () from /lib/libc.so.6
#3 0xb77dac07 in g_logv () from /usr/lib/libglib-2.0.so.0
#4 0xb77dac42 in g_log () from /usr/lib/libglib-2.0.so.0
#5 0xb6ca7f54 in ?? () from /usr/lib/libgthread-2.0.so.0
#6 0xad41a3c0 in ?? () from /usr/lib/gstreamer-0.10/libgstcoreelements.so
#7 0xb786f07c in g_object_unref () from /usr/lib/libgobject-2.0.so.0
#8 0xb78c6cdf in gst_object_unref () from /usr/lib/libgstreamer-0.10.so.0
#9 0xb78f40af in ?? () from /usr/lib/libgstreamer-0.10.so.0
#10 0xb78f7bac in gst_mini_object_unref () from /usr/lib/libgstreamer-0.10.so.0
#11 0xb78d4b93 in ?? () from /usr/lib/libgstreamer-0.10.so.0
#12 0xb77d1b72 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#13 0xb77d2350 in ?? () from /usr/lib/libglib-2.0.so.0
#14 0xb77d2a1b in g_main_loop_run () from /usr/lib/libglib-2.0.so.0
#15 0xb6ed75b9 in gtk_main () from /usr/lib/libgtk-x11-2.0.so.0
#16 0xb7c5a7a8 in wxEventLoop::Run() () from /usr/lib/libwx_gtk2u_core-2.8.so.0
#17 0xb7ce454e in wxAppBase::MainLoop() () from /usr/lib/libwx_gtk2u_core-2.8.so.0
#18 0xb7ce3e91 in wxAppBase::OnRun() () from /usr/lib/libwx_gtk2u_core-2.8.so.0
#19 0xb7eef09b in wxEntry(int&, wchar_t**) () from /usr/lib/libwx_baseu-2.8.so.0
#20 0xb7eef147 in wxEntry(int&, char**) () from /usr/lib/libwx_baseu-2.8.so.0
#21 0x0814f9bb in main (argc=1, argv=0xbffff754) at /home/tian/guayadeque/src/MainApp.cpp:36
(gdb)
User avatar
anonbeat
Posts: 2048
Joined: Thu Sep 16, 2010 9:47 pm

GStreamer-CRITICAL

Post by anonbeat »

Can you provide more details about what you were playing and which mode ? crossfading? gapless? what action you did ?

Thanks for your help
mr_hangman
Posts: 70
Joined: Tue Sep 28, 2010 12:22 am

GStreamer-CRITICAL

Post by mr_hangman »

It happened again for the second time.
The settings are
First time - no crossfading, smartmode on. It probably crashed at the end of a song while I was away from the computer.
screenshot - http://img715.imageshack.us/img715/9726 ... ersdoh.png

Second time - no crossfading, smartmode off. Crashed at 00:03 of a song after I clicked play.
screenshot - http://img526.imageshack.us/img526/8526 ... lenkag.png

This is the log for the second crash http://pastebin.com/EspPfsZV
User avatar
anonbeat
Posts: 2048
Joined: Thu Sep 16, 2010 9:47 pm

GStreamer-CRITICAL

Post by anonbeat »

This is the problem

09:13:40 PM: Error: Gstreamer error 'Could not decode stream.'

Looks like that tracks cant be played. Could you please send me that tracks that caused the problem ?

Thanks for your help
mr_hangman
Posts: 70
Joined: Tue Sep 28, 2010 12:22 am

GStreamer-CRITICAL

Post by mr_hangman »

I'm sending 2 songs to your email. I can't reproduce the crash though.

And this is the first part of the the second crash (before Gstreamer error) that was not in my previous post http://pastebin.com/Xe8E9sZa

Thank you
mr_hangman
Posts: 70
Joined: Tue Sep 28, 2010 12:22 am

GStreamer-CRITICAL

Post by mr_hangman »

I just got another crash today on rev 1439.

This is the complete log http://pastebin.com/q3iCdRzG

I tried to reproduce the crash but couldn't :(
Locked